What Exactly is a Shipping Container Corner Fitting?

A shipping container corner fitting, often simply called a corner casting, is a standardized cast steel component found at all eight corners of an ISO shipping container. Manufactured to stringent international standards (ISO 1161), these fittings are designed to be the primary structural connection points for lifting, securing, and stacking containers. Each container, regardless of its size (8ft, 10ft, 20ft, or 40ft), is equipped with these robust fittings, ensuring universal compatibility across the global logistics network. These fittings are crucial for container integrity.

These specialized castings feature precisely engineered openings that allow for the attachment of twist locks, lashing rods, and lifting equipment. Without a high-quality shipping container corner fitting, the safe and efficient transport of goods across oceans, roads, and rail lines would be impossible. They are the universal interface that makes containerized transport the standardized, secure, and efficient system it is today. The Unsung Heroes: Why Corner Fittings Matter So Much

The significance of a shipping container corner fitting extends far beyond its physical presence. It is a critical component that underpins the entire functionality and safety of a shipping container. Here’s why these fittings are so crucial:

  • Structural Integrity: Corner fittings are integral to the container’s structural frame, contributing significantly to its strength and rigidity. They absorb and distribute forces during handling and transport, preventing structural deformation.
  • Secure Stacking: When containers are stacked, twist locks engage with the corner fittings of both the upper and lower containers, creating a secure, interlocked stack. This is vital for stability, especially on cargo ships navigating rough seas or in container yards in Eldoret experiencing strong winds.
  • Safe Lifting and Handling: Cranes use specialized lifting equipment (spreaders) that attach directly to the corner fittings. These fittings are engineered to withstand immense loads, ensuring containers can be safely lifted, moved, and positioned without compromise. This is particularly important for large 40ft high-cube containers handled in ports and depots across Kenya.
  • Efficient Lashing and Securing: During transit, containers must be securely fastened to vessels, trucks, or railcars to prevent movement. Lashing rods and chains connect to the corner fittings, providing the necessary anchoring points. This securement is vital for protecting cargo during long hauls from Mombasa to inland towns like Kisii or Mandera.
  • Universal Compatibility: Adherence to the ISO 1161 standard means that any shipping container corner fitting, regardless of its origin, will be compatible with standard handling equipment and other containers worldwide. This global standardization is what makes the container shipping industry so efficient.

Types and Orientation of Shipping Container Corner Fittings

While all shipping container corner fitting units are manufactured to the ISO 1161 standard, they come in specific types based on their position on the container. There are eight corner fittings on every container:

  • Top Corner Fittings: Four fittings located at the top corners of the container. These are designed to accept lifting gear from above and to interlock with the bottom fittings of an container stacked above.
  • Bottom Corner Fittings: Four fittings located at the bottom corners of the container. These provide the primary contact points for resting the container on the ground or on the deck of a ship/chassis, and for interlocking with the top fittings of a container stacked below.

Furthermore, each corner fitting is unique to its specific corner location on the container, meaning there are actually 8 different types of castings: top-left front, top-right front, top-left rear, top-right rear, bottom-left front, bottom-right front, bottom-left rear, and bottom-right rear. This precise design ensures maximum strength and functionality for each specific application point.

Understanding these distinctions is crucial, especially when sourcing replacement parts or undertaking complex container modifications. Manufacturing and Quality Standards: The ISO 1161 Benchmark

The manufacturing of a shipping container corner fitting is a highly specialized process governed by the international standard ISO 1161. This standard dictates the dimensions, material specifications, and mechanical properties that all corner fittings must adhere to. Typically, they are made from high-grade cast steel, selected for its exceptional strength, durability, and resistance to impact and harsh environmental conditions.

Adherence to ISO 1161 is not just a recommendation; it’s a mandatory requirement for any container intended for international transport. This ensures that every shipping container corner fitting can withstand the rigorous demands of global logistics, including the immense stresses of lifting fully loaded containers, the dynamic forces at sea, and the weight of multiple stacked containers. Securing Your Investment: Twist Locks and Lashing with Corner Fittings

The true utility of a shipping container corner fitting is fully realized when paired with securing mechanisms like twist locks and lashing equipment. These accessories are designed to slot precisely into the openings of the corner fittings, creating a secure connection essential for preventing movement during transport or storage.

  • Twist Locks: These are locking devices inserted into the corner fitting. Once in place, a lever is twisted, causing a cam to rotate and lock the two connected fittings together. Twist locks are fundamental for stacking containers safely on top of each other, whether on a ship, train, or in a container yard in Mombasa.   • Lashing Rods and Chains: For securing containers to a flatbed truck, railcar, or ship’s deck, lashing equipment is used. Lashing rods, chains, or straps are hooked into the corner fittings and then tightened, preventing any horizontal or vertical movement of the container. Maintenance and Longevity of Corner Fittings

Despite their robust construction, shipping container corner fitting units can be subject to wear and tear, especially in demanding operational environments. Regular inspection and maintenance are crucial to ensure their continued functionality and safety. Corrosion, dents, or cracks can compromise their structural integrity, making them unsafe for handling or stacking.

In Kenya’s diverse climate, from the coastal humidity of Mombasa to the arid conditions of Kajiado, corner fittings can be exposed to elements that accelerate rust.
